Your distance exceeds your displacement if you pedal a bicycle down a straight road for 500 meters before turning around and pedaling back.
Distance is a measure of how far apart two objects or locations are using numbers. Distance can refer to a physical length or an estimate based on other factors in both daily language and physics (e.g. "two counties over"). It is sometimes used to indicate the distance between two points: display style |AB||AB|. The terms "distance from A to B" and "distance from B to A" are frequently used interchangeably. A distance function or metric is a way to describe what it means for elements of some space to be apart in mathematics. It generalizes the idea of physical distance.

<u>According to Thomas and Chess, temperament is comprised of the individual differences concerning self-regulation, emotions, and motor reactivity. Those characteristics are consistent over time and across situations.</u> There are three general types of temperament in children:
- Easy children adjust to new situations and are active and happy since birth.
- Difficult children are hard to satisfy. They do not adjust easily, express negative moods intensely, and present irregular routines.
<u>- Slow-to-warm-up children are less active babies since birth. They can show some difficulty adjusting to new situations.</u>
